Following today’s announcement that Helium One Global Ltd (AIM:HE1, OTCQB:HLOGF) has kicked off drilling for the Tai-3 well in Tanzania, analysts at SP Angel suggested the group is now “fully funded” to move onto a second exploration well on the Itumbula prospect ahead of the wet season.

Helium One previously suggested that Itumbula drilling would commence immediately after the Tai-C programme, using proceeds from a £6.8 million subscription and retail offer.

Ondine Biomedical Inc (AIM:OBI) said first-half results were in line with expectations as it looks ahead to a phase three study of Steriwave, its nasal photodisinfection candidate.

A challenging economic backdrop and unfavourable stock markets meant the deferral of 2023 fundraising plans but the Canadian company said it made significant progress nonetheless.

University spinouts have seen a first drop in investment for more than a decade, according to a new report.

Parkwalk, the UK’s largest spinout investor, commissioned a report showing the number of funding deals rising to a record 414 last year, but the value fell by £400 million to £2.3 billion and has tumbled to £743 million in the first half of 2023.

Helium One Global Ltd (AIM:HE1, OTCQB:HLOGF) told investors that drilling has now kicked off for the Tai-3 well in Tanzania.

Drilling began earlier on 25 September and is slated to comprise around 1,100 metres with target depth (TD) anticipated within two weeks.

Pantheon International PLC (LSE:PIN) has released further details on its £200 million share buyback scheme announced in August.

Since that announcement, Pantheon has bought approximately £7.35 million from the market at prices ranging from 269.5p to 281.5p.

Empire Metals Ltd (AIM:EEE) has raised £3 million to expand its drilling plans at the Pitfield deposit in Western Australia.

A 1,500-metre diamond core programme is already underway with this additional funding earmarked for a second phase of reverse circulation exploration in early 2024 focusing on very dense zones recently identified within the magnetics anomaly.
